Transaction 447882e7115bf4f2c27dfc3141a678da27b5122b53455cf92bad8f535305a894

1 Input
2 Outputs
  • 447882e7115bf4f2c27dfc3141a678da27b5122b53455cf92bad8f535305a894:0
  • value  4627600
    address  1MhiUbWhrTrjZx59XYiCYB2u2SX59M8hZm
  • 447882e7115bf4f2c27dfc3141a678da27b5122b53455cf92bad8f535305a894:1
  • value  52886
    address  17xhmAzKAAbqk1eDLJswyAHV7SPqfnFP7s